Output da3e26ecaeae4b037e61175f144be80a43e68f1e4a4ff5586931a019a6392960:11

value
418728026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ddfdbb7c55d151dd5b53e709ac3d77db584572 OP_EQUAL
address
MH6VjpzGQY9Az2PeXxf983kJCEpo3pUrLU
transaction
da3e26ecaeae4b037e61175f144be80a43e68f1e4a4ff5586931a019a6392960
spent
true